Lucknow, June 4 (UNI) Lucknow Bench of Allahabad High Court today posted for hearing to June 11, the petition of Uttar Pradesh Chief Election Commissioner (CEC) Aparmita Prasad Singh challenging his removal from the post.

A vacation bench comprising Justices Sanjay Mishra and Rajiv Sharma passed this order.

In his petition, Mr Singh had claimed he was removed unconstitutionally, which would adversely affect the rule of law and democracy.

However, the state government contended the CEC was removed after effecting relevant amendment in rules and hence the step was well within the legal purview.
